The ability to boot from a VHD file was introduced with Windows 7. This feature, coupled with the use of differencing disks enables easy backups of entire hard disk images and creation of restore points. Differencing disks are also useful when there is a need for a base hard drive image that needs slight customization for different groups of users or workstations such as staff and students.

In the presentation I will demonstrate:

-How to create a VHD using GUI and command line tools
-Installing Windows 7 into a VHD
-Creating boot entries in the boot manager
-How to create a differencing disk
-Backing up and reverting disk images
-Using the Disk to VHD tool to convert physical disks to VHDs
